Canon CanoScan LiDE 60 Flatbed Scanner

Currently unavailable.
Key Features
  • Type: Flatbed Scanner
  • Interface: USB 1.1 USB 2.0
  • Optical Resolution: 1200 dpi
  • Max. Resolution (Hardware): 1200 x 2400 dpi
  • Max. Resolution (Interpolated): 19200 x 19200
  • Platform: PC, Mac
